What is a DBE job?

A DBE (Disadvantaged Business Enterprise) job typically involves managing or supporting projects that promote the participation of small, disadvantaged businesses in transportation and infrastructure contracts. A DBE Program Manager oversees compliance, certification processes, and outreach efforts to ensure equitable opportunities for certified businesses. The role often requires knowledge of federal regulations, certification standards, and project management skills.

What are the main challenges a DBE Program Manager might face when ensuring compliance with federal and state regulations?

A DBE Program Manager often encounters challenges related to interpreting and applying complex federal and state requirements, especially as regulations can frequently change. Ensuring that all contractors and subcontractors understand and comply with these rules requires ongoing training, communication, and documentation. Additionally, the role involves monitoring participation goals, conducting regular audits, and resolving disputes, all while fostering positive relationships between diverse business entities and prime contractors. Strong organizational and interpersonal skills are essential to effectively navigate these challenges.

What are DBE Program Managers?

DBE Program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ing and implementing Disadvantaged Business Enterprise (DBE) programs, typically within government agencies or organizations that receive federal funding. Their primary role is to ensure compliance with federal and state DBE regulations, promote participation of minority- and women-owned businesses in public contracting, and monitor program effectiveness. They also conduct outreach, track contractor performance, and report on DBE participation to stakeholders.

Cosmoprof is a respected name in the beauty industry, headquartered in Denton, TX, United States. This multinational company, accessible via cosmoprofbeauty.com, is a leader in the wholesale distribution of professional beauty products and equipment. It operates by a business-to-business model, catering extensively to salon professionals and beauticians. Its portfolio includes a wide range of products such as hair care, skin care, nail care, tools and accessories, salon furniture, and equipment from leading beauty brands. The company was founded with the intention to nurture the growth of the professional beauty sector.
